Control Air Travel Cost

Air travel can be a very efficient way to get from one place to another. Some people say that the world has gotten smaller because we can go from one continent to another in a matter of hours on a plane compared to weeks on ship that people endured in past generations. This convenience comes at a price. Most airlines are in business to make a profit. They accomplish this through complex pricing strategies. There are two tried and true methods that can help keep the cost of airline tickets at their minimum.

Booking flights on the internet has changed the face of air travel. This allows the consumer to view different flight options and pricing based on their criteria at their leisure. The range of fares for a particular route will vary depending on factors like the season, time of day, day of the week, and overall demand. Adjusting the dates or timing of your trip, if possible, can reduce the cost of travel significantly.

A second method to keep air travel costs low is to book ahead. Supply and demand play into pricing structures of many airlines. If you wish to book a trip leaving tomorrow, your options may be limited. Many airlines work hard to sell as many seats on every flight as early as possible. A last-minute traveler may have a limited number of options regarding flights and travel times. The pricing can be much higher on these seats due to supply and demand. Booking a flight as early as possible can save a lot of expense.

What to Do on a Family Vacation to Seattle

The Space Needle is a tower in Seattle, Washin... 

Image via Wikipedia

Seattle is one of the nation’s most interestingand beautiful cities. As such, it is a great place to take the kids on a family vacation any time of the year. There are parks, beaches, museums, and many other attractions that your kids will love. Below are two fan favorites.

The Seattle Children’s Museum is a very popular destination for families with children 5-6 years of age. Located in Seattle Center a short walking distance from the Space Needle, the children’s museum has many different activities for kids to enjoy. These include:

  • An arts and crafts room that showcases paintings, drawings, and the opportnity to make a clay sculpture or use recycled materials to build something unique.
  • An area known as the “glocal village.” Here kids can visit places around the world such as Ghana, Japan, and the Phillipines, among others. It’s s truly cultural experience.
  • A staging area where kids can form a group, dress up as whomever they want, and put on a play for the adults.

The Seattle Aquarium is right on the waterfront. There is a special tank where kids can touch starfish, sea urchins, and other sea life. Another exhibit shows what a salmon run would look like. There are also exhibits for seals and sea otters, both of which offer feeding shows a few times during the day. These feeding times also offer a learning experience about the animals and the kids can even feel an otter pelt! And don’t forget to visit the exhbiti inside where there is a big octopus on display!

Tips to Reduce Jet Lag During Travel

Jet travel can bring on some undesirable effects when on a long trip. Nobody has more experience in this area than professional pilots who often travel across multiple times zones, and sometimes the international date line, many times per week or even in the same day. Because of the nature of their work (travel long distances and provide safety to passengers) they have developed some hints to reduce the effects of jet travel over long distances.

Set your watch. If your trip will last longer than a day or two and the travel crosses two or more time zones, set your watch to the destination time zone as soon as you take off. You can plan your meals and sleep schedule based on the new time. If the trip is only for a day and you are returning to your home time zone, it often makes more sense to keep your watch and your schedule for meals and sleep synchronized to the time at home.

Rest. If your new time zone is earlier than home, it may be a challenge to go to sleep hours earlier than your body may be used to. In this instance, try to allow the same number of hours of sleep that you normally get. If you can go to sleep a little earlier than normal and rise a little bit later, your feeling of fatigue should be lowered.

These two tips can make a big difference in your travel. Being alert and productive on a trip has benefits-even if you don’t have the lives of 200 passengers on your hands. Take it from the pros.

Three Tips to Keep Accomodations Costs Down

Travel can be expensive. Accommodations can add up to the biggest expense on a holiday trip. There are several ways to get the most for your travel dollar. It takes a little bit of planning but the payoff can be huge.

Internet booking can be one of the most effective ways to make reservations for your accommodations. It saves time because some websites allow you to set your specifications and search only the hotels that interest you. You can set parameters for things like quality or star rating, pet friendly, kid friendly, and proximity to attractions. This type of research can also allow you to compare rates for multiple properties and verify vacancies. It is not always possible to walk into a hotel and obtain a room without a reservation. Hotel sales staffs do their best to fill the hotel every night by booking groups and business travelers well in advance. Using the internet to search and secure reservations can save both time and money.

We just talked about using the internet to find a great deal on accommodations. There is another tool that should be used with this process. It is called the telephone. Websites mentioned above can provide a great service to show locations, amenities and availability along with prices. The only drawback to using a site that considers multiple hotels is that they often receive a commission for showcasing the property and providing you, the customer, with a portal to make a reservation. Hotels almost always have deals that only a reservations agent at that property or hotel chain can offer. Calling the hotel directly allows the hotel to save on the commission that they may have to pay an internet site for selling their rooms. There are also local conditions that may allow the hotel to offer discounts or added value to their stay that will not show up on an internet search.

Using these two tools together can go along way to control the cost of accomodations. Getting a good value for business or pleasure is always a good thing.

It Pays to Stay Current on Insurance Needs

One can reap big savings by adjusting their level of insurance as their needs change. It’s not easy to keep this topic in mind-especially as major life events are happening. Keeping up with your needs can yield savings of hundreds if not thousands of dollars in the course of a year. Events that bring about the need to change levels of coverage can be family status or the status of an auto loan.

Big savings can be had when adjusting for a smaller family. Having teenagers in the household can bring about very high rates for coverage. It is important to have coverage adjusted when these drivers move out of the household.  The annual rates can drop significantly when going from a house with teen drivers to a home with only adults. Teen drivers do not have the experience and generally have higher chances of involvement in an accident. This is the driver of higher rates for younger drivers.

The next event that can deliver big savings in annual premiums is the status of a car loan. Most finance companies that underwrite car loans will require full coverage on the vehicle in the event of collision or other comprehensive damage. This coverage is in addition to the liability coverage that most local governments require. This protects the asset (the vehicle) of the owner (the finance company or bank). When the loan is paid in full there are some decisions to make. Oftentimes a car has depreciated considerably when the initial loan is paid off. The cost associated with full coverage insurance on the vehicle that would cover replacement can be high. If the value of the car has dropped from the initial sticker price, it may make sense to drop this extra coverage and be prepared to repair or replace the vehicle if it is damaged or lost by the policy holder.

The events above are just two of many things that change in our lives all the time. It can pay to assess your insurance needs periodically and make the adjustments as they are needed.
